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Diseño de pruebas de los servicios​

  • Account​

  • Balance​

Se identificaron los HappyPath y casos excepciones de los servicios mencionados.​

NOTA: La unica diferencia entre los casos de prueba y el CSV es el diseño del formato.

View file
nameDiseño de pruebas v3.xlsx

View file
nameDiseño de pruebas v2.xlsx

...

Para garantizar la calidad del código que estamos desarrollando, es importante tomar en cuenta el diseño y ejecución de pruebas, para ello la creación de los casos de pruebas.

La prueba del software consta de tres pasos:

  1. El entorno de la prueba

  2. Desarrollar y ejecutar scripts

  3. Analizar los resultados

Componentes:

Un caso de prueba es un conjunto de acciones con resultados y salidas previstas basadas en los requisitos de especificación del sistema; sus componentes basados en el framework de QA Spin son:

  • Título

  • Descripción

  • Precondiciones

  • Pasos

  • Resultado esperado

  • Prioridad

  • Sección

  • Suite

  • Tipo

  • Estimación

Plantilla casos de prueba

Para este proyecto, se tiene contemplado usar la plantilla que nos hace llegar el equipo de QA Spin para documentar los casos de prueba en CSV previo a la carga en la herramienta de testrail.

Se han creado casos de prueba para los siguientes componentes:

Herramienta a utilizar:

Testrail.

TestRail es una solución de gestión de casos de prueba para aseguramiento de la calidad (QA) y equipos de desarrollo, que está diseñada para ayudar a los usuarios a organizar, gestionar y rastrear el proceso de prueba del software de la empresa.

Es la herramienta en la que actualmente Spin monta y ejecuta las pruebas automatizadas.

Fuente: https://www.getapp.com.mx/software/112767/testrail#:~:text=TestRail%20permite%20a%20los%20usuarios,cambios%20para%20garantizar%20la%20transparencia.